Nagoshi Studio Producer Daisuke Sato Lists Himself as Former Staff
Sato's profile change is the strongest personnel signal yet that Nagoshi Studio may be winding down, even as the studio itself has not confirmed closure or cancellation of its announced game.
Reporting from 1 sources: Inside.
Daisuke Sato, a producer and director at Nagoshi Studio, has changed his X profile to read "Former Nagoshi Studio." The studio, founded by Toshihiro Nagoshi as a NetEase subsidiary, announced its debut title "GANG OF DRAGON" in December 2025 but has since faced funding cuts and a dark website. No official statement on the studio's status has been made.
Daisuke Sato, who joined Nagoshi Studio as a founding member after leaving Sega, now lists himself as a former employee on X. The studio's official website has been inaccessible since May, and reports in March indicated NetEase planned to cut funding. The studio's X account remains active but posts infrequently. The Steam page for "GANG OF DRAGON" is still live, and no cancellation has been announced.
